Abstract
Grandjean (1983), Ong (1988) and Hsu and Wang (2000) et al. reported that fewer complaints were found with preferred workstation settings at an adjustable VDT workstation than with the imposed settings from a general non-adjustable VDT workstation. However, the cost of the fully adjustable VDT workstation is not affordable for general companies and VDT users. Therefore, how to improve the non-fully adjustable VDT workstation based on the preferred setting data in a cost effective way such as by using adjustable keyboard trays will be a feasible alternative. Currently, only little VDT workstation preferred setting data was reported for Taiwanese VDT users. Most of the VDT workstations used in industry or by personal VDT users in Taiwan were not designed based on adequate domestic preferred setting data. Inadequate height of desk or keyboard tray for placing keyboard and mouse was the major defect. Besides, the width of keyboard tray was found insufficient for placing keyboard and mouse together compared with preferred setting data. Therefore, the aims of this study are first to evaluate VDT workstation preferred settings data for Taiwanese VDT users and then use adjustable keyboard tray as an intervention to improve the field VDT workstation in a cost-effective way. Three adjustable keyboard trays and two fixed keyboard trays which will be used as controls will be evaluated in this study. The subjects will be selected based on the results of subjective visual and musculoskeletal discomfort questionnaire and clinical examination conducted by a doctor as well. The intervention will be assessed after two to three months again by questionnaire and clinical examination. In addition to the evaluation of the effects of using adjustable keyboard trays on improving musculoskeletal discomforts, the preferred settings data evaluated can also be used for the design of VDT workstation for Taiwanese VDT users.
